In 1925, Zora Neale Hurston became one of the leaders of the

Harlem Renaissance. Her first production was the short-

lived literary magazine "Fire", along with Langston Hughes

and Wallace Thurman. Many readers objected to the

representation of African-American dialect in her novels.

Some critics felt that her decision to render language in

this way caricatured black culture. Now... she is being

praised for her ability to capture the actual spoken idiom

of the day.

The work she is most famous for... There Eyes Were Watching

God, was written in 1937. She spent the last decade of her

life as a freelance writer for magazines and news papers.

She died of a stroke and was buried in and unmarked grave.

What did zora neale hurston done for African American?

Zora Neale Hurston was an influential African American author, anthropologist, and folklorist known for her contributions to African American literature during the Harlem Renaissance. She is best known for her novel "Their Eyes Were Watching God." Hurston's work celebrated African American culture, dialect, and folklore, helping to bring these rich traditions into mainstream American literature.
